The Prostate Cancer Score in 54216, Kewaunee, Wisconsin is 87 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

84.64 percent of the population in 54216 drive to work alone. 0.07 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 59.50 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 4.10 percent of the residents in 54216 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.01 members with about 2.45 cars available per household.

An estimate of 95.80 percent of the residents in 54216 has some form of health insurance. 36.57 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 76.54 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 54216 would have to travel an average of 21.98 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Aurora Medical Ctr Manitowoc County .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 54216, Kewaunee, Wisconsin.

As of , an estimate of 5,977 residents live in 54216 with a median age of 47.1 years. 17.30 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 24.48 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 37.34 percent of the residents in 54216 is currently married, and 21.31 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 54216 is $7,013.92.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 54216 is approximately $824. The median household spends about 11.75 percent of their income on housing.
